For Lucy and Tim, this season has been defined by the "will they/won't they" dynamic finally shifting into "they are." However, "The Collar" tests their professional boundaries. The episode does a superb job of highlighting Lucy’s growth. She is no longer the timid rookie; she is a capable officer with aspirations for undercover work. The writing here is sharp, showing that their relationship doesn't diminish their professional capabilities but rather complicates their emotional stakes.
